A New Type of Classification Algorithm Inspired by the Chromatographic Separation Mechanismthm inspired by the method of chromatographic separation of chemical substances. This method is widely and successfully used in analytical chemistry. Auto-LVEF: A Novel Method to Determine Ejection Fraction from 2D Echocardiogramstermine left ventricular ejection fraction from a 2-dimensional Transthoracic Echocardiogram (2D TTE) without any human intervention at any point of the process. Our model was evaluated on the EchoNet-Dynamic dataset and it outperforms current state-of-the-art models with an accuracy of 0.97 measured in . while still being a white box model.
